Bleeding Kansas (1 июн 1854 г. – 1 янв 1861 г.)
Описание:
Bleeding Kansas is a time in history when violence broke out in the Kansas territory. The Missouri Compromise was overturned in 1854 by the Kansas-Nebraska Act. The Missouri Compromise was the use of latitude as a boundary between the slave and free states but the Kansas-Nebraska Act used popular sovereignty that allowed the residents to decide whether the area became a free state or a slave state. Pro slavery and anti-slavery settlers flocked to Kansas to try and influence the decision. Violence later erupted as both fought for control. John Brown, an abolitionist, led anti-slavery fighters in Kansas before the raid on Harpers Ferry.
